With its lovingly maintained structure and fully enclosed garden boasting two gated access points, this house provides both seclusion and accessibility that aren't always easy to come by.

The home is just a quick five-minute drive from the quaint town of Villefagnan. Here, you'll discover a delightful mix of small shops, cozy restaurants, a café brimming with local flavor, and even a medical center for necessities—not to mention the friendly and welcoming locals who will make you feel right at home. If you're in need of more extensive amenities, a short ten-minute drive leads you to Ruffec. This bustling town caters to all practical requirements and offers more comprehensive shops and facilities.

Let's walk through the home together, shall we? As you enter, you're greeted by a spacious living area that promises warmth and homeliness. The ground floor features a fully equipped kitchen—imagine the aroma of fresh baguettes wafting through as you prepare meals here. Adjacent is a dining room complemented by a wood burner, providing the perfect cozy spot to enjoy homemade French cuisine during the colder months. The ground level also includes a shower room and WC, adding an element of practicality to its charm. Another gem on this level is the large living room with another wood burner, its cathedral ceiling offering a stunning visual appeal and creating a wonderfully open space.

Journey to the first floor, and a mezzanine greets you, which can effortlessly be transformed into an office or serene reading area. Picture unwinding here with a novel in hand. Beyond the mezzanine lie two en suite bedrooms—each a tranquil retreat within the home. There's another bathroom/WC as well as two additional spaces currently serving as offices but easily convertible into a third bedroom with the necessary permissions. Talk about versatility!

Outside, the property truly shines for those who love al fresco living. An expansive terrace with a BBQ area makes entertaining a breeze, while an 8x4 swimming pool offers a refreshing escape during the hot summer days characteristic of this region.
